diff options
Diffstat (limited to 'utils/tests/base64.js')
-rwxr-xr-x | utils/tests/base64.js | 23 |
1 files changed, 0 insertions, 23 deletions
diff --git a/utils/tests/base64.js b/utils/tests/base64.js deleted file mode 100755 index 09bcd34..0000000 --- a/utils/tests/base64.js +++ /dev/null @@ -1,23 +0,0 @@ - -var base64 = require('base64.js'); -var binary = require('binary'); -var assert = require('test/assert.js'); - -var raw = "Once upon a time, in a far away land.\n"; -var encoded = 'T25jZSB1cG9uIGEgdGltZSwgaW4gYSBmYXIgYXdheSBsYW5kLgo='; - -exports.testEncode = function () { - assert.eq(base64.encode(raw), encoded, 'encoded'); -}; - -exports.testDecode = function () { - assert.eq(base64.decode(encoded), raw, 'decoded'); -}; - -exports.testEncodeDecode = function () { - assert.eq(base64.decode(base64.encode(raw)), raw, 'encode decode identity'); -}; - -if (require.main === module.id) - require("os").exit(require("test/runner").run(exports)); - |